Tóm tắt
| This paper presents an approach to tackle the high-dimensional dataset problem for the hedge algebras based classification method proposed in N. C. Ho, D.T. Pedrycz, D. T. Long, and T. T. Son. “A genetic design of linguistic terms for fuzzy rule based classifiers." International Journal of Approximate Reasoning, vol. 54, no. 1. pp. 1 21, 2013 by utilizing the featureselection algorithm proposed in X. Sun, Y. Liu, M. Xu,H. Chen, J. Han, and K. Wang, “Feature selection using dynamic weightsfor classification," Knowledgr--Based Systems, vol. 37, pp. 541—549, 2013.Theproposed method is also compared with three classical classification methods based on the statisticaland probabilistic approaches showing that it is a robust classifier. |
